Solana Mobile, a subsidiary of blockchain developer Solana Labs, has unveiled its decentralized architecture, TEEPIN, and plans for a native token, SKR, while confirming an Aug. 4 shipping date for its highly-anticipated second crypto smartphone, "Seeker."
To support Solana Mobile's expansion to more hardware makers and decentralize its web3 ecosystem, TEEPIN (Trusted Execution Environment Platform Infrastructure Network) will introduce a three-layer architecture enabling secure, trustless mobile access for developers, users, and manufacturers, according to a statement on Wednesday.
"TEEPIN represents the next evolution in mobile — a framework where trust isn't granted by a central authority but verified through cryptography," Solana Labs co-founder and CEO Anatoly Yakovenko said. "By leveraging secure hardware that already exists on modern smartphones and governing access on-chain, we're unlocking open innovation, platform ownership, and a decentralized future for mobile."
SKR is designed to power economics, incentives, and ownership across the ecosystem, and will go directly to builders and users, the team said on X.
"Aligning incentives is essential to building a truly decentralized and self-sustaining mobile ecosystem," Solana Mobile General Manager Emmett Hollyer said. "It transforms the traditional mobile business model by giving stakeholders actual ownership in the platform. Instead of being passive consumers in someone else's walled garden, users, developers, and hardware manufacturers become active stewards of a community-owned digital infrastructure."
Shipping Seeker
Previously dubbed "Chapter Two" when the stealth phase of the cheaper successor to its popular Solana Saga device was launched in January, Solana Mobile claims presales for the new phone have now surpassed 150,000 units across 57 countries at an "early adopter" price of $500.
Seeker includes a hardware Seed Vault, Genesis Token, and new features like Seed Vault Wallet, Seeker ID, and an upgraded Solana dApp Store with improved onchain UX.
